Microsoft has patched a total of 74 flaws in its software as part of the company's Patch Tuesday updates for August 2023, down from the voluminous 132 vulnerabilities the company fixed last month. This comprises six Critical and 67 Important security vulnerabilities. An unknown threat actor is using a variant of the Yashma ransomware to target various entities in English-speaking countries, Bulgaria, China, and Vietnam at least since June 4, 2023. Cisco Talos, in a new write-up, attributed the operation with moderate confidence to an adversary of likely Vietnamese origin. Debian Linux Security Advisory 5468-1 - The following vulnerabilities have been discovered in the WebKitGTK web engine. YeongHyeon Choi discovered that processing web content may disclose sensitive information. Narendra Bhati discovered that a website may be able to bypass the Same Origin Policy. Narendra Bhati, Valentino Dalla Valle, Pedro Bernardo, Marco Squarcina, and Lorenzo Veronese discovered that processing web content may lead to arbitrary code execution. Various other issues were also addressed.

Cisco Talos is seeing an increasing number of ransomware variants emerge, since 2021, leading to more frequent attacks and new challenges for cybersecurity professionals, particularly regarding actor attribution.
Cisco Talos discovered an unknown threat actor, seemingly of Vietnamese origin, conducting a ransomware operation that began at least as early as June 4, 2023 with customized Yashma ransomware.
